Right at Borehamwood & Watford is a home care agency based in Borehamwood, which provides the best possible, person-centred care in their local communities and areas such as Borehamwood, Shenley, Radlett, Watford, Rickmansworth and surrounding areas.

They have over 40 years’ experience between them both in care and nursing within the NHS and in the community and have extremely high standards and expectations in the service they provide.

The team at Right at Home Borehamwood take pride in offering personalised home care, elderly care at home, and live-in care solutions.

The staff are also trained in complex care needs which can include:

•       Bowel and Stoma Care
•       Motor Neurone Disease
•       PEG/Water Balloon Feeding
•       Non-Invasive Ventilation
•       Dementia Care
•       Diabetes Management
•       Epilepsy Support

All of the services are personalised to each individual through a Personal Support Plan that is delivered by the highly-trained Care Givers. If you cannot see the services you need, they may be able to source training in order to meet your requirements.

The clients receive support for the full time that they pay for, as Care Givers travel in their own time.

The visits are never rushed.

Care Givers are carefully matched to Clients and, time allowing, introduced to each other before your care begins.

There is a professional dress code and no distinguishable uniform, as the team recognise that some Clients prefer a discreet service when out and about in the local community.

Funding & Fees

  • Hourly Visiting Care Fees: from £35
  • Weekly Live-in Care Fees: from £1400

If you or your loved one requires support in travelling with no aliments or adjustments, the cost is 65pence per mile.


We do have a wheel chair accessible, company car that is available for hire to use, this is £45.00 per hour Monday - Friday and £50.00 Saturday and Sunday

These prices are only a guideline, please contact Right at Home (Borehamwood & Watford) to find out the exact price for your requirements.

Overview of Review Score

The Review Score of 9.9 (9.912) out of 10 for Right at Home (Borehamwood & Watford) is based on a) the Average Rating and b) the number of positive Reviews.

  1. The Average Rating is 4.9 out of 5 from 19 Reviews in the last 24 months.
  2. The score for the number of positive Reviews is 5.0 out of 5 from 19 positive Reviews in the last 24 months.

Detailed Breakdown of Review Score

The maximum Review Score for a Home Care Provider is 10, which is made up from the Average Rating of Reviews (maximum of 5 points) and the Number of Reviews (maximum of 5 points) in the last 24 months:

  1. 5 Points are available for the Average Rating from all Reviews in the last 24 months. The Average Rating of 4.912 for Right at Home (Borehamwood & Watford) is calculated as follows: ( (103 Excellents x 5) + (10 Goods x 4) ) ÷ 113 Ratings = 4.912
  2. 5 Points are available for the number of Positive Reviews in the last 24 months. A Positive Review is defined as any Review with an 'Overall Experience' of '4' or '5' (out of a max rating '5').

    The 5 points available are broken down as follows: 3 points for the first Positive Review, 2 points in total for each of the next 9 Positive Reviews (1st = 3, 2nd = 0.5, 3rd = 0.5, 4th = 0.25, 5th = 0.25, 6th = 0.1, 7th = 0.1, 8th = 0.1, 9th = 0.1, 10th = 0.1)

    The 5 points relating to the number of Positive Reviews for Right at Home (Borehamwood & Watford) is based on 19 Positive Reviews in the last 24 months and is calculated as follows: 3 + 0.5 + 0.5 + 0.25 + 0.25 + 0.1 + 0.1 + 0.1 + 0.1 + 0.1 = 5
  3. When a Review is submitted by someone who has previously submitted a Review, only the latest Review will count towards the Review Score.
  4. If a Home Care Provider does not have a review in the last 24 months, then it will not have a Review Score.
